If you've ever wished for a personal assistant who could read things aloud for you, then NaturalReader - Text to Speech might just be the app of your dreams. I recently gave it a whirl and here's my take on how it stacks up.

First Impressions and Setup

Getting started with NaturalReader - Text to Speech was a breeze. The installation was quick, and the user interface greeted me with a simple, clean design. No clutter, just straightforward options that make navigation a cinch. You can dive right into the features without feeling overwhelmed—a big thumbs up for usability!

After launching the app, I was prompted to select a voice. There are quite a few to choose from, and I have to say, the variety is impressive. Whether you prefer a soothing British accent or a more energetic American tone, they've got you covered. Setting up your preferences is as easy as pie, and you can even tweak the speed and pitch to suit your taste.

How It Works

Once you're all set up, using the app is as intuitive as it gets. You just have to upload your text or document, hit play, and voila! The app starts reading it to you. I tried it with a few different formats—PDFs, Word docs, even some web pages—and it handled them all with aplomb. The text-to-speech conversion is smooth, with minimal lag.

One of the standout features is the app's ability to maintain the natural flow of speech. It doesn't sound robotic, which is a huge plus. The intonation and pauses feel just right, almost like having a real person read to you. It's a delight for anyone who needs to process a lot of written content on the go.

Features That Shine

There's more to NaturalReader than just its core reading capabilities. The app also offers a handy bookmark feature, allowing you to save your place and return to it later. This is especially useful if you're going through a lengthy document and need to pause and resume later.

Another feature worth mentioning is the ability to convert text into audio files. You can save these as MP3s, which means you can listen to your documents offline. Perfect for those times when you're out and about without internet access.

For those who like to multitask, the app can run in the background while you use other apps. So, you can have it read your emails while you're checking social media or getting some work done. It's a neat way to maximize your time.

Room for Improvement?

No app is perfect, and while NaturalReader does a commendable job, there's always room for improvement. One thing I noticed is that the free version has limited options compared to the premium version. While this is expected, it might be a bit of a letdown for users who aren't ready to commit to a subscription.

Additionally, while the voice selection is extensive, it would be great to see even more regional accents and languages included in future updates. This would make the app even more accessible to a wider audience.

Final Thoughts

Overall, NaturalReader - Text to Speech is a solid choice for anyone looking to convert text to spoken word. Whether you're a student needing to read through loads of material, a professional who prefers listening to reports, or just someone who loves multitasking, this app has something to offer.

It’s easy to use, with a range of features that enhance the listening experience. The voice options are diverse enough to keep things interesting, and the ability to create audio files is a game-changer. While there are some limitations in the free version, the premium features might just be worth the investment if you find yourself using the app frequently.

So, if you're in the market for a text-to-speech app, give NaturalReader a try. It might just become one of your new favorite tools!

Frequently Asked Questions

What platforms is NaturalReader - Text to Speech available on?

NaturalReader - Text to Speech is available for both Android and iOS devices. Users can download it from the Google Play Store or the Apple App Store. This makes it accessible for a wide range of mobile users, allowing them to utilize its features across different devices, including smartphones and tablets.

Does NaturalReader support multiple languages?

Yes, NaturalReader supports multiple languages, making it a versatile tool for users around the world. It includes a wide array of languages and dialects, enhancing accessibility for non-English speakers. This feature is especially useful for users looking to improve language skills or needing assistance with reading comprehension in various languages.

Can I use NaturalReader offline?

NaturalReader does offer offline functionality, allowing users to download certain voices for use without an internet connection. This feature is particularly beneficial for those who need text-to-speech capabilities on the go, without relying on continuous internet access. However, some advanced features may require online access.

What customization options does NaturalReader offer?

NaturalReader provides several customization options, including adjustable speech speed and voice selection. Users can choose from a variety of voices and set the reading pace to suit their preferences. This flexibility ensures a more personalized experience, accommodating different reading styles and preferences.

Is there a free version of NaturalReader available?

NaturalReader offers a free version with basic features, allowing users to test the app’s core functionalities without any cost. For users seeking more advanced features, such as premium voices and additional languages, a subscription or one-time purchase option is available. This tiered approach caters to both casual users and those needing more comprehensive capabilities.
